Output ecc6b9167fd9dc8aa5e2f0b8cb28ac64cfa6c63ed7052d005dea585ba7a02e5e:0

value
5308587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c61f45e7d830d01b9b4838d8c751a951abe8e052 OP_EQUAL
address
3KkbBR9NazRi9LyvWccjFiTW4btZ5UBTjn
transaction
ecc6b9167fd9dc8aa5e2f0b8cb28ac64cfa6c63ed7052d005dea585ba7a02e5e